AN ACT concerning education.
| ||||
Be it enacted by the People of the State of Illinois,
| ||||
represented in the General Assembly:
| ||||
Section 5. The School Code is amended by changing Section | ||||
2-3.163 as follows: | ||||
(105 ILCS 5/2-3.163) | ||||
Sec. 2-3.163. PUNS Prioritization of Urgency of Need for | ||||
Services database information for students and parents or | ||||
guardians . | ||||
(a) The General Assembly makes all of the following | ||||
findings: | ||||
(1) Pursuant to Section 10-26 of the Department of | ||||
Human Services Act, the The Department of Human Services | ||||
maintains a statewide database known as the PUNS database | ||||
Prioritization of Urgency of Need for Services that | ||||
records information about individuals with intellectual | ||||
disabilities or developmental disabilities who are | ||||
potentially in need of services. | ||||
(2) The Department of Human Services uses the data on | ||||
PUNS Prioritization of Urgency of Need for Services to | ||||
select individuals for services as funding becomes | ||||
available, to develop proposals and materials for | ||||
budgeting, and to plan for future needs. |
(3) The PUNS database Prioritization of Urgency of | ||
Need for Services is available for children and adults | ||
with intellectual disabilities or a developmental | ||
disabilities disability who have an unmet service needs | ||
need anticipated in the next 5 years. The PUNS database is | ||
also available for children with intellectual disabilities | ||
or developmental disabilities with unmet service needs. | ||
(4) Registration to be included on the PUNS database | ||
Prioritization of Urgency of Need for Services is the | ||
first step toward receiving getting developmental | ||
disabilities services in this State. A child or an adult | ||
who is If individuals are not on the PUNS database will not | ||
be Prioritization of Urgency of Need for Services waiting | ||
list, they are not in queue for State developmental | ||
disabilities services. | ||
(5) Lack of awareness and information about the PUNS | ||
database results in underutilization or delays in | ||
registration for the PUNS database by students with | ||
intellectual disabilities or developmental disabilities | ||
and their parents or guardians Prioritization of Urgency | ||
of Need for Services may be underutilized by children and | ||
their parents or guardians due to lack of awareness or | ||
lack of information . | ||
(a-5) The purpose of this Section is to ensure that each | ||
student with an intellectual disability or a developmental | ||
disability who has an individualized education program ("IEP") |
and the student's parents or guardian are informed about the | ||
PUNS database, where to register for the PUNS database, and | ||
whom they can contact for information about the PUNS database | ||
and the PUNS database registration process. This Section is | ||
not intended to change the PUNS database registration process | ||
established by the Department of Human Services or to impose | ||
any responsibility on the State Board of Education or a school | ||
district to register students for the PUNS database. | ||
(a-10) As used in this Section, "PUNS" means the | ||
Prioritization of Urgency of Need for Services database or | ||
PUNS database developed and maintained by the Department of | ||
Human Services pursuant to Section 10-26 of the Department of | ||
Human Services Act. | ||
(b) The State Board of Education may work in consultation | ||
with the Department of Human Services and with school | ||
districts to ensure that inform all students with intellectual | ||
disabilities or developmental disabilities and their parents | ||
or guardians are informed about the PUNS Prioritization of | ||
Urgency of Need for Services database , as described in | ||
subsections (c), (c-5), and (d) of this Section . | ||
(c) The Subject to appropriation, the Department of Human | ||
Services , in consultation with the and State Board of | ||
Education , shall develop and implement an online, | ||
computer-based training program for at least one designated | ||
employee in every public school in this State to educate the | ||
designated employee or employees him or her about the PUNS |
Prioritization of Urgency of Need for Services database and | ||
steps required to register students for the PUNS database, | ||
including the documentation and information parents or | ||
guardians will need for the registration process to be taken | ||
to ensure children and adolescents are enrolled . The training | ||
shall include instruction on identifying and contacting for at | ||
least one designated employee in every public school in | ||
contacting the appropriate developmental disabilities | ||
Independent Service Coordination agency ("ISC") to register | ||
students for the PUNS database enroll children and adolescents | ||
in the database . The training of the designated employee or | ||
employees shall also include information about organizations | ||
and programs available in this State that offer assistance to | ||
families in understanding the PUNS database and navigating the | ||
PUNS database registration process. Each school district shall | ||
post on its public website and include in its student handbook | ||
the names of the designated trained employee or employees in | ||
each school within the school district. At least one | ||
designated employee in every public school shall ensure the | ||
opportunity to enroll in the Prioritization of Urgency of Need | ||
for Services database is discussed during annual | ||
individualized education program (IEP) meetings for all | ||
children and adolescents believed to have a developmental | ||
disability. | ||
(c-5) During the student's annual IEP review meeting, if | ||
the student has an intellectual disability or a developmental |
disability, the student's IEP team shall determine the | ||
student's PUNS database registration status based upon | ||
information provided by the student's parents or guardian or | ||
by the student. If it is determined that the student is not | ||
registered for the PUNS database or if it is unclear whether | ||
the student is registered for the PUNS database, the parents | ||
or guardian and the student shall be referred to a designated | ||
employee of the public school who has completed the training | ||
described in subsection (c). The designated trained employee | ||
shall provide the student's parents or guardian and the | ||
student with the name, location, and contact information of | ||
the appropriate ISC to contact in order to register the | ||
student for the PUNS database. The designated trained employee | ||
shall also identify for the parents or guardian and the | ||
student the information and documentation they will need to | ||
complete the PUNS database registration process with the ISC, | ||
and shall also provide information to the parents or guardian | ||
and the student about organizations and programs available in | ||
this State that offer information to families about the PUNS | ||
database and the PUNS database registration process. | ||
(d) The State Board of Education, in consultation with the | ||
Department of Human Services, through school districts, shall | ||
provide to the parents and guardians of each student with an | ||
IEP students a copy of the latest version of the Department of | ||
Human Services's guide titled "Understanding PUNS: A Guide to | ||
Prioritization for Urgency of Need for Services" each year at |
the annual review meeting for the student's individualized | ||
education program , including the consideration required in | ||
subsection (e) of this Section .
| ||
(e) (Blank). The Department of Human Services shall | ||
consider the length of time spent on the Prioritization of | ||
Urgency of Need for Services waiting list, in addition to | ||
other factors considered, when selecting individuals on the | ||
list for services. | ||
(Source: P.A. 102-57, eff. 7-9-21.)
